Study in Germany

Germany's public universities charge little or no tuition, and their degrees are recognised worldwide. Applicants from India go through APS verification, prove their funds through a blocked account, and meet a language requirement in German or English depending on the programme they choose.

Requirements

What you will need

  • 10+2 for a bachelor's — via Studienkolleg where your qualification needs topping up
  • A recognised bachelor's degree for a master's programme
  • An APS certificate — mandatory for applicants from India
  • Language proof: TestDaF, Goethe or telc for German-taught programmes; IELTS or TOEFL for English-taught
  • A blocked account (Sperrkonto) as proof of funds, at the amount set for the year
  • Health insurance, motivation letter, CV and letters of recommendation

Step by Step

Your Study journey

We stay with you through every stage — the language, the paperwork and the move itself.

  1. 1

    Shortlist Programmes

    Match your background and budget to universities and courses that will actually admit you.

  2. 2

    Get Your APS Certificate

    Document verification through APS India — start early, it takes time.

  3. 3

    Reach the Language Level

    B2 or C1 German for German-taught programmes, or an English test for English-taught ones.

  4. 4

    Apply

    Through uni-assist or directly to the university, with a complete document set.

  5. 5

    Receive Admission

    Review your offer and the conditions attached to it.

  6. 6

    Blocked Account & Insurance

    Open your Sperrkonto and arrange student health insurance.

  7. 7

    Student Visa

    We prepare your file and your interview.

  8. 8

    Travel & Enrol

    Arrive, register your address and matriculate at your university.
